How much does a mechanical engineer make compared to a civil engineer? The median annual wage for a mechanical engineer was $85,880 in May 2024. The median annual wage for a civil engineer was $85,480 in May 2024. What are the benefits of a career in mechanical …

Civil Engineers made a median salary of $88,050 in 2024. The best-paid 25% made $117,270 that year, while the lowest-paid 25% made $74,250.
